Synopsis
Following the popular Stumpwork Dragonflies and Stumpwork Beetles, Stumpwork Butterflies & Moths is the third in a series of stitched insect collections. Jane Nicholas has created a "specimen box" of jewels with 18 Lepidoptera, all chosen for interest, color, and to showcase an assortment of materials and techniques.
